## **Friends of Clayton Parks** 

## **Annual Report 2023/2024** 

This year has seen projects and new members joining our small but active group of Volunteers. Residents of the area all keen to help sustain and keep our parks and green spaces clean and a safe space to enjoy our beautiful heritage. We have an excellent service from our District Council and Parish council. We are all custodians of the are we appreciate and Treasure. 

Throughout the year 2023 to 2024 we have celebrated the Queens Platinum Jubilee with an event in Victoria Park Clayton, many people attended to share in the fun games and celebrations. We have held litter picks in different areas in howling gales and rain. Our stalwart members determined to keep Clayton Green and litter free. We have several groups that regularly litter pick different areas and spaces. Our local park is litter picked every morning by a local member. And twice per week by the district council staff. We have recruited  new members at the Jubilee event, and we grow at every event and opportunity. 

We have started work on the area called Tea Pot Spout. We obtained a grant from Clayton Parish Council to clear this small piece of land and make it accessible. This will give a viewpoint overlooking the valley to Thornton and the surrounding villages and communities. A glorious view what ever the weather. An ongoing project that will hopefully be ready in the next budget year. 

We have plans to join Clayton Village  and the Parish Council at the Christmas Lights Switch On 2024 with a lantern parade for the children and adults to create a lantern to light the way through the park to join the choir outside the village hall where the Christmas tree and the lights around the streets will be officially switched on.  An event to plan and look forward to. We plan this to be an annual event in our calendar which will grow and evolve over time, to publicise and grow members and participation. 

We are looking forward to our next financial year 2024/25 with energy and enthusiasm.
